Pay Tuition in Full

Students or their employers may pay in full for the Nurse Aide Training (NAT). This is the preferred method. Payments will only be accepted in the following forms: money order, certified funds check, credit card, or debit card. No cash or personal checks will be accepted. Payments can be made online at:

Payment Plan

Students may be given the option to engage in a payment plan. All students engaged in a payment plan must agree to the terms of the Payment Plan & Refund Policy:

The cost of the training can be broken down into three equal payments. The first (1st) payment for the Nurse Aide Training is due by the end of the first week of the curriculum; the second (2nd) payment is due before the start of the clinical training; and the final third (3rd) and final payment is due before course completion. If any payment is delinquent, you cannot proceed with the Nurse Aide Training until all accounts have been settled.

Refund Policy

  1. If a student has paid for tuition in full before the start of Nurse Aide Training, the student may be eligible for a refund within the first week of the curriculum.
  2. An administrative fee of $150 will be deducted from the tuition and may take up to 6 weeks to process.
  3. No refund is given if the withdrawal request is made after the first week of the curriculum.
  4. The application fee is non-refundable in any event.
  5. No refund is given if termination by the school for any Code of Conduct violation.
